Output 12cca2d3c1ffa52cd0193b1a9fb85543a7f1d059b6b2a37e1ad460877b185b15:50

value
2592663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dae02cefc87c0e91cb6d86642187b6f292573a9 OP_EQUAL
address
3AEMDstWpB6Z1ZxFvzWm1ZNfq9V5dudx8L
transaction
12cca2d3c1ffa52cd0193b1a9fb85543a7f1d059b6b2a37e1ad460877b185b15
spent
true